A clean sans with gently rounded geometry and low-contrast strokes. Curves are smooth and broadly circular, with softened joins and terminals that read as subtly rounded rather than sharply cut. Counters are open and generous, and proportions feel balanced and even, producing a steady rhythm in both capitals and lowercase. Figures follow the same simplified, rounded construction for consistent texture in mixed text.
It suits interface typography, product and SaaS branding, and general-purpose editorial layouts where a clean, approachable sans is needed. The open shapes and even rhythm also work well for short signage, headings, and presentation decks where clarity at a glance matters.
The overall tone is neutral and contemporary with a friendly edge. Its softened forms keep it from feeling rigid or technical, while the orderly proportions maintain a professional, dependable voice.
The design appears intended as a versatile everyday sans that balances geometric simplicity with softened details for approachability. Its consistent stroke behavior and open counters suggest a focus on clear, calm reading in a wide range of contemporary layouts.
Round letters like O and Q appear broadly oval with smooth continuity, and several forms (such as a, e, and s) emphasize openness and clarity. The design avoids decorative quirks, relying on consistent curvature and straightforward construction to stay legible and calm.
